With both this cuvée and the wonderful Les Rugiens-Hauts, Leroux is back in Pommard with a bang. The 2018 is a blend of Les Vaumuriens (high on the slope) and Les Cras (on the lower slope), both vineyards that lie on the Volnay side of the village. In terms of power, Pommard brought the thunder in 2018, although Leroux notes the cooler, hillside fruit from Les Vaumuriens brought excellent balance to the blend. This was crafted from 100% de-stemmed berries and raised with roughly 20% new oak. We have very little. Very deep and very classy.
“From Cras and Vaumuriens, so a mix of the flat land and the hillside. Deep concentrated red with a most delicious bouquet, heady but balanced with floral notes too. Succulent red fruit, really stylish for Pommard, backed by some habitual tannins.” Jasper Morris, Inside Burgundy
